About this Guide

Public Engagement is a strategic focus area here at the University of Michigan, there is even a Michigan Public Engagement Framework which has been developed which includes 12 different public engagement domains. This guide is a bit less theoretical and a bit more focused on the nuts and bolts of engaging the public with science. With that in mind this guide has been split into three different sections: Outreach and Education, which talks about in-person engagement such as classroom visit, public lectures, and science museums; Science Communication, which covers both creating your own stories and working with the media; and Community and Governmental Engagement, which includes information for how to work with the local and federal government, take part in policy and advocacy, and collaborate with community groups.

Before going further though, a quick disclaimer about public engagement of all types. When you engage with the public you are representing your institution, as well as yourself, and there can be situations where it may be best to check-in with your institution, be it at a departmental, school, or higher level, before moving forward.
